Nothing is as black and white as we think, and we can't take the mainstream narratives at face value. In this episode, Jeremy and David discuss the lack of transparency in provincial elections, the role of religion in politics, and misleading media coverage of global conflicts. Which headlines are a distraction of the real issues at hand? And how should citizens get involved?
